We are looking for a dynamic and business-savvy Product Manager (Non-Tech) to drive strategic initiatives and optimize product performance from a market, customer, and process perspective.
In this role, you will be responsible for managing end-to-end product lifecycle, improving customer experience, aligning cross-functional teams, and contributing to business growth-without direct ownership of technical development.
This role is ideal for professionals with a background in business operations, strategy, sales enablement, customer success, marketing, or process improvement who are looking to move into or expand their impact in product management.
Key Responsibilities :
Define and maintain product vision and roadmap in alignment with business goals
Conduct market research, customer interviews, and competitor analysis to inform strategy
Gather and prioritize business and user requirements from internal stakeholders and end users
Collaborate with cross-functional teams including design, operations, sales, and customer success to execute product initiatives
Drive go-to-market strategy and product launch plans in coordination with marketing and sales
Analyze product performance using KPIs and customer feedback to inform enhancements and optimizations
Identify opportunities to improve customer satisfaction, retention, and operational efficiency
Own documentation such as user stories, requirement briefs, product decks, and customer journeys
Act as the voice of the customer and ensure alignment across departments on product goals
Ensure compliance with regulatory, legal, and internal policy requirements for product offerings
